Transaction

1e66500ea2decb6d26d034b7a680eb5aa138e06b9ba48a1e37328a8c19b41c98
249,866 confirmations
Timestamp
1623696673
Block687,585
Fee5,757 sats
Fee rate25.8 sats/vB
view on mempool.space

Inputs & Outputs